PURPOSE:To obtain a sintered beta-SiC having high strength, by mixing SiC powder having high beta-SiC content with B or B carbide and a carbonaceous additive in a solvent capable of dissolving said additive, drying and forming the mixture, calcining the product while exhausting generated gas and sintering the calcined material under the introduction of Ar gas. CONSTITUTION:SiC powder having an average particle diameter of <=1mum and containing >=90wt.% of beta-SiC is mixed with 0.3-1.1wt.% of B or B carbide (in terms of B) having an average particle diameter of <=0.5mum and 2-3wt.% of a carbonaceous additive (in terms of C). The carbonaceous additive is e.g. a phenolic resin. The mixture is mixed in a solvent capable of dissolving said carbonaceous additive (e.g. alcohol), dried and molded. The molded product is calcined in vacuum by raising the temperature up to 1,500 deg.C to carbonize the carbonaceous additive and exhaust the generated gas. The calcined product is sintered at 1,960-2,100 deg.C under introduction of Ar gas. A sintered SiC having high strength can be efficiently produced on an industrial scale at a low cost. |
